HEALTH IN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Y (HIT) Health Information Technology uses computers and computer programs to store, protect, retrieve, and transfer clinical, administrative, and financial information electronically. Health Information Technology (HIT) has the potential to improve the health of individuals and the performance of providers, yielding improved quality, cost savings of patients in their own health care. Benefits of electronic medical records in the rhu Paperless transactions to patient encounter during consultation in the Rural Health Unit Systematic recording and storage of patient records which will make health care services easily upon follow-up check-up. Fast-paced of patient interaction and management also saves time during consultation. Effective and efficient delivery of health services through appropriate information and communication strategy. Aid in health decision-making by the health care providers. Easy retrieval of patient records, history and previous management.
